Types of Printer Paper
Comprehending the various kinds of printer paper is important for picking the right one for your requirements. Below is a comprehensive table detailing several typical types of printer paper, their characteristics, and suitable uses.

Requirement Copy Paper
Standard copy paper is created for daily A4 Printing Paper requirements. It is bright white, smooth in texture, and normally weighs around 20 pounds. This paper is perfect for printing text files, memos, and other standard paperwork.
2. Picture Paper
For those who value print quality, photo paper is important. Offered in shiny and matte surfaces, image paper is normally much heavier than regular paper, making it ideal for high-resolution images and lively colors.
3. Cardstock
Cardstock is thicker and tougher than basic paper, which makes it suitable for printing company cards, invitations, and crafting jobs. Its numerous colors and textures can improve the visual appeal of printed products.
4. Resume Paper
When printing expert documents, resume paper is an outstanding option. Usually much heavier than standard copy paper and of exceptional quality, this paper conveys professionalism and care in presentation.
5. Labels
Label paper is specifically designed for printing sticker labels and labels. It includes an adhesive support and can be formatted to fit basic printer settings. This paper is best for developing shipping labels, address labels, or customized sticker labels.
6. Legal Paper
Legal-sized paper is larger than basic letter-sized paper and is typically utilized for official files such as contracts and legal briefs. This type of paper is usually smooth and can deal with high-quality printing.
7. Specialty Paper
Specialty paper encompasses a variety of textures and finishes, including linen and parchment. This kind of paper is typically used for art prints, greeting cards, and other distinct tasks that require a touch of beauty.
Factors to Consider When Buying Printer Paper Online
When purchasing printer paper online, a number of elements need to be weighed to ensure that the paper satisfies your requirements:
1. Purpose of Use
Recognizing the purpose of your prints is important. If printing files for expert use, choose for premium resume paper. For individual tasks like scrapbooking, specialty paper may be preferable.
2. Paper Weight
Paper weight is determined in pounds (lbs) and affects its density and resilience. For general printing, a weight of 20 lbs suffices, whereas photo printing might require paper weights of 30 lbs or more.
3. End up Type
The surface of the paper (glossy, matte, or textured) greatly affects the final print quality. Glossy surfaces are ideal for images, while matte finishes offer a more subdued look appropriate for text-heavy files.
4. Size
Make certain to pick the correct size of paper for your printer. Typical sizes consist of letter (8.5" x 11"), legal (8.5" x 14"), and A4 Paper Store (8.27" x 11.69"). Ensuring compatibility with your printer design is important to prevent paper jams or misprints.
5. Brand name Reliability
Selecting a credible brand can make a distinction in print quality and performance. Research and read reviews of numerous brands to assess their reliability and suitability for your specific printing needs.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Can I utilize routine copy paper for photo printing?
While regular copy paper can be used for standard photo printing, it will not produce the exact same quality as dedicated picture paper. Utilizing photo paper ensures lively colors and sharper images.
2. How do I know if the paper will deal with my printer?
Constantly examine your printer's specs for suitable paper types and sizes. Many printer manufacturers provide guidelines on the kinds of paper that work best.
3. Is it worth buying specialty paper?
If you plan to print items like welcoming cards or art prints, specialty paper can improve the overall feel and look of your tasks. The financial investment can settle in terms of quality.
4. What is the difference in between glossy and matte paper?
Glossy paper has a glossy finish that boosts colors, making it perfect for photos. Matte paper has a non-reflective finish, which is better for text files or art prints that need a more subtle appearance.
5. Can I find eco-friendly printer paper online?
Yes, numerous merchants now offer environmentally friendly printer paper made from recycled products. Try to find papers labeled as "recycled" or "sustainable" for environmentally-conscious choices.
